    Armenia's pro-Western PM wins re-election with 49.8%, vows to continue pivot from Moscow despite Russian disinformation campaign

    Prime Minister Nikol Pashinyan's Civil Contract party secured a parliamentary majority with 49.81% of the vote, defeating three pro-Russian opposition blocs in an election marred by disinformation and arrests.
